🔧 Geek Corner (Flashing Info)

  • Chipset: Beken BK24xx Series (Likely BK2421/BK2422)
  • Flashable: ❌ No
  • Info: RF 433MHz devices typically use proprietary chips and protocols, making them difficult or impossible to flash with custom firmware like Tasmota or ESPHome.

The device under test is manufactured by the grantee ( Sensata Technologies ) and sold as an 
OEM product. Per 47 CFR 2.909, 2.927, 2.931, 2.1033, 15.15(b) etc…, the grantee must 
ensure the end-user has all applicable / appropriate operating instructions. When end-user 
instructions are required, as in the case of this product, the grantee must notify the OEM to 
notify the end- user. Sensata Technologies will supply this document to the 
reseller/distributor dictating what must be included in the end user’s manual for the commercial 
product. 

INFORMATION TO BE INCLUDED IN THE END USER'S MANUAL 

The following information ( in blue ) must be included in the end product user’s manual to 
ensure continued FCC and Industry Canada regulatory compliance. The ID numbers 
must be included in the manual if the device label is not readily accessible to the end 
user. The compliance paragraphs below must be included in the user's manual.
